Index

Symbols

+noppu 14, 639, 701, 732

Itanium processor 15, 640, 703, 733 Itanium processors 15, 640, 703, 733 PA-RISC 14, 640, 702, 733

+ppu 14, 639, 701, 732

Itanium processor 15, 640, 703, 733 Itanium processors 15, 640, 703, 733 PA-RISC 14, 640, 702, 733

1-way Dissection reordering 934

A

accessing

VECLIB 3 accessing VECLIB 3

accuracy of computed eigenvaules and eigenvectors 1018

apply Givens rotation general 114 modified 123 sparse 120

arguments

BLAS Standard 36 array

Fortran argument association 34 Fortran storage 34l

sort 620

auxiliary subprograms 651–685

B

backward storage 35 band symmetric matrix

compute norm 666

Basic Linear Algebra Subprograms. See BLAS.

BCSLIB-EXT 1081–1083 accessing 1082

associated documentation 1082 functionality 1082

bibliography xxv

BLAS

calling XERBLA 337 defined 31 extended, defined 205 indexing conventions 35 Level 2 and 3 defined 205 sparse 31, 421

BLAS legacy routines 211

BLAS Standard 3, 31, 36, 152, 209, 339, 437

error handling 605

operate with complex conjugate 26 operator arguments 25

routines, alphabetical list 152–189, 339–361

See F_ for alphabetical list of routines

C

C language

calling LAPACK from 627, 1085 calling MLIB routines from 1087 calling VECLIB from 1085 header files 1089

C1DFFT 541

C2DFFT 547

C3DFFT 551 CAXPY 65 CAXPYC 65 CAXPYI 68 CBCOMM 441 CBDIMM 445 CBDISM 449 CBELMM 453 CBELSM 457 CBSCMM 461 CBSCSM 465 CBSRMM 469 CBSRSM 473 CCOOMM 477 CCOPY 80 CCOPYC 80 CCSCMM 481 CCSCSM 485 CCSRMM 489, 497 CCSRSM 493 CDIASM 501 CDOTC 84 CDOTCI 88 CDOTU 84 CDOTUI 88 CELLMM 505, 513 CELLSM 509, 517 CFFTS 556 CGBMV 212 CGECPY 219 CGEMM 222 CGEMMS 227 CGEMV 232 CGERC 237

1107